php如何部署本地服务器上
- 编程技术
- 2025-01-31 23:27:33
- 1
在PHP中部署本地服务器通常意味着将你的PHP应用程序从本地开发环境迁移到可以供他人访问的服务器上。以下是一般步骤: 1. 准备工作安装PHP:确保你的服务器上已经安装...
在PHP中部署本地服务器通常意味着将你的PHP应用程序从本地开发环境迁移到可以供他人访问的服务器上。以下是一般步骤:
1. 准备工作
安装PHP:确保你的服务器上已经安装了PHP。
安装数据库:如果你的应用程序使用了数据库(如MySQL),确保数据库服务器也已安装并运行。
配置服务器:如果是使用Apache或Nginx作为服务器软件,确保它们已正确配置。
2. 准备你的应用程序
代码审查:确保你的代码没有安全漏洞,并且已经过充分的测试。
文件结构:确保你的应用程序的文件结构清晰,并且所有必要的文件都已包含在内。
3. 部署到服务器
以下是一个简单的步骤指南:
使用FTP/SFTP
1. 连接到服务器:使用FTP或SFTP客户端连接到你的服务器。
2. 上传文件:将你的应用程序文件上传到服务器的相应目录。
3. 配置文件:根据需要修改配置文件,如`.htaccess`或`php.ini`。
使用Git
如果你使用Git进行版本控制,以下步骤可能更适合你:
1. 创建远程仓库:在你的服务器上创建一个新的远程仓库。
2. 推送代码:将你的本地代码库推送到远程仓库。
3. 部署脚本:使用如Capistrano这样的工具来自动化部署过程。
4. 配置数据库
如果你的应用程序使用数据库:
1. 创建数据库:在服务器上的数据库服务器中创建相应的数据库。
2. 导入数据:如果有必要,从本地数据库中导出数据,并在服务器上导入。
3. 配置数据库连接:更新你的应用程序中的数据库连接信息。
5. 测试
本地测试:在服务器上运行你的应用程序,确保一切按预期工作。
性能测试:进行性能测试,确保应用程序可以处理预期的负载。
6. 安全性
更新和打补丁:确保你的服务器软件和应用程序都是最新的,以防止安全漏洞。
配置防火墙:配置防火墙规则,以限制不必要的访问。
7. 监控
日志记录:确保你的应用程序有适当的日志记录,以便于监控和调试。
性能监控:使用工具来监控应用程序的性能。
以上步骤可能因你的具体需求而有所不同。如果你使用的是特定类型的Web服务器或自动化部署工具,请参考相应的文档。
本文链接:http://xinin56.com/bian/412823.html
上一篇:iphone4s换卡后如何激活
下一篇:win7 如何禁止修改ip